Come aggiungere il chatbot IA Asyntai a Kentico
Guida passo passo per i siti web Kentico CMS
Passaggio 1: ottieni il tuo codice di incorporamento
Per prima cosa, vai alla tua Dashboard Asyntai e scorri fino alla sezione "Codice di incorporamento". Copia il tuo codice di incorporamento univoco che apparirà così:
<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>
Nota: Il codice sopra è solo un esempio. Devi copiare il tuo codice di incorporamento univoco dalla tua Dashboard poiché contiene il tuo ID widget personale.
Passaggio 2: Aggiungi il codice al Master Page Template (consigliato)
Per aggiungere il chatbot a tutte le pagine del tuo sito web Kentico contemporaneamente, utilizza il metodo Master Page Template:
- Accedi al tuo pannello di amministrazione Kentico e naviga all'applicazione Page templates
- Individua e apri il tuo Master page template (il template utilizzato in tutte le pagine)
- Clicca sulla scheda Header nell'editor del template
- Nella sezione header, incolla il tuo codice di integrazione Asyntai
- In alternativa, aggiungi il codice al layout del template prima del tag di chiusura </head>
- Clicca su Save per applicare le modifiche
- Svuota la cache del tuo sito e verifica le modifiche sul sito live
Suggerimento: L'utilizzo del Master Page Template garantisce che il chatbot appaia su ogni pagina che eredita da questo template. Questo è il metodo più efficiente per una distribuzione su tutto il sito in Kentico.
Metodo alternativo 1: Header del Page Template
Se desideri aggiungere il chatbot solo a template di pagina specifici:
- Vai all'applicazione Page templates in Kentico Admin
- Seleziona il template di pagina specifico che desideri modificare
- Clicca sulla scheda Header
- Aggiungi il tuo codice di integrazione Asyntai utilizzando un tag script:
<script async src="https://asyntai.com/static/js/chat-widget.js" data-asyntai-id="YOUR_WIDGET_ID"></script>
- Clicca su Save
- Tutte le pagine che utilizzano questo template ora includeranno il chatbot
Nota: Questo metodo è utile quando desideri aggiungere il chatbot a sezioni specifiche del tuo sito che condividono lo stesso template di pagina, piuttosto che all'intero sito.
Metodo alternativo 2: Web Part HEAD HTML
Per un controllo più granulare su pagine specifiche o per JavaScript ereditabile nelle sottopagine:
- Apri la pagina che desideri modificare nell'editor di pagina Kentico
- Aggiungi una nuova web part alla pagina (preferibilmente in una pagina padre per l'ereditarietà)
- Cerca e seleziona la web part HEAD HTML
- Nella configurazione della web part, incolla il tuo codice di integrazione Asyntai
- Configura la web part come ereditabile se desideri che le pagine figlie abbiano il chatbot
- Clicca su OK per salvare la web part
- Salva e pubblica la pagina
Suggerimento: La web part HEAD HTML è perfetta per aggiungere codice a una pagina padre che si propagherà automaticamente a tutte le pagine figlie, creando un'installazione a livello di sezione.
Metodo alternativo 3: File JavaScript personalizzati (avanzato)
Per gli sviluppatori che preferiscono gestire gli script come file:
- Nel tuo progetto Kentico, naviga nella directory ~/CMSScripts/Custom/
- Crea un nuovo file JavaScript (es. asyntai-widget.js)
- Aggiungi il codice per caricare dinamicamente il tuo widget Asyntai:
(function() {
var script = document.createElement('script');
script.src = 'https://asyntai.com/static/js/chat-widget.js';
script.setAttribute('data-asyntai-id', 'YOUR_WIDGET_ID');
script.async = true;
document.head.appendChild(script);
})();
- Fai riferimento a questo file nell'intestazione del tuo Master Page Template:
<script src="~/CMSScripts/Custom/asyntai-widget.js"></script>
Importante: Questo metodo avanzato richiede l'accesso al file system e la conoscenza della struttura delle directory di Kentico. Assicurati di avere i permessi appropriati e di testare sempre prima in un ambiente di staging.
Passaggio 3: verifica l'installazione
Dopo aver salvato le modifiche e svuotato la cache, apri il tuo sito web in una nuova scheda del browser o in una finestra di navigazione in incognito. Dovresti vedere il pulsante del widget chat nell'angolo in basso a destra. Cliccaci sopra per assicurarti che si apra e funzioni correttamente.
Non vedi il widget? Assicurati di aver salvato tutte le modifiche e svuotato la cache di Kentico (Settings > System > Clear cache). Prova a visualizzare il tuo sito in una finestra di navigazione in incognito. Controlla la console del browser (F12) per eventuali errori JavaScript che potrebbero impedire il caricamento del widget.
Weebly